St Vincent de Paul Society

There are three categories of membership of the Society.

1. Conference members are those who belong to the grassroots groups within the Society known as conferences. They live their Catholic faith in action through the spirit of Christian charity.

2. Associate members are those who are committed to the ethos, mission, aims and objects of the Society and who assist the work of the Society, but do not attend conference meetings.

3. Volunteer members are those who respect the ethos, mission, aims and objects of the Society and who volunteer in any of the Society’s works.

St Vincent de Paul’s Assistance Centre is situated at Shop 15 Riviera Plaza. People are welcomed in a clean and secure place and are treated with respect and dignity. No work of charity is foreign to conference members. They visit people in their homes, in the hospital, aged care facilities or wherever else people may be found needing aid or comfort. Members also meet and pray together at others times.

Vinnies Conference offers a way for students to participate in the Society’s transformative work. Mini Vinnies at St Mary’s School is a program designed for primary level students. We encourage participating students to live their faith in a three-pronged way: ‘See’ (education and awareness). ‘Think’ (formation and reflection) and ‘Do’ (community service and fundraising). St Mary’s Op Shop

St Mary’s Opportunity Shop is run by volunteers. It is located next door to the Salvo Op Shop on MacLeod Street. The St Mary’s Op Shop stocks a wide range of donated items including furniture, electrical goods, clothing, footwear, toys and books. Everything you buy or donate inspires change in our local community, with profits being used to fund St Mary’s Church Restoration Project and local St Vincent de Paul Conference services and programs.
